109年第2學期-0858 電腦程式設計 課程資訊
評分方式
評分項目 | 配分比例 | 說明 |
---|---|---|
Assignments | 20 | |
Midterm | 30 | |
Project | 40 | |
Participation | 5 | |
Quizzes | 5 | |
TA | 5 |
選課分析
本課程名額為 70人,已有49 人選讀,尚餘名額21人。
登入後可進行最愛課程追蹤 [按此登入]。
教育目標
本課程是以Python為基礎,進行進階電腦程式設計。Python程式語言是一種物件導向、直譯式電腦程式語言。它包含了一組完善而且容易理解的標準庫,能夠輕鬆完成很多常見的任務。Python具有跨平台的特性,許多網頁程式或是系統管理都是透過Python來完成。Python同時也是Google愛用的程式語言,像是Google的搜尋引擎初期就是利用Python建構完成的。本學期會回顧基本的程式邏輯開始進行,再藉由Python的語法來進行實作,並學習運用相關套件,來開發一實用性應用程式。
課程資訊
基本資料
必選課,學分數:0-3
上課時間:三/6,7,8,9[ST021]
修課班級:工工系1B
修課年級:年級以上
選課備註:由系辦統一分班
教師與教學助理
授課教師:王怡然
大班TA或教學助理:尚無資料
Office Hour星期二[10:30am~12:30pm]工工系 E218室 33500轉126
星期五[10:30am~12:30pm]工工系 E218室 33500轉126
授課大綱
授課大綱:開啟授課大綱(授課計畫表)
(開在新視窗)
參考書目
Bill Lubanovic, Introducing Python, O’Reilly Media, Inc.
開課紀錄
您可查詢過去本課程開課紀錄。 電腦程式設計歷史開課紀錄查詢